Michael Moorcock's Eternal Champion has many different incarnations across the Multiverse: Elric, Hawkmoon, Corum, Erekosë, John Daker, Jerry Cornelius, etc.

 

How would you design something like this in Hero?  Multiform and Extra-Dimensional Movement with No Conscious Control?  Completely separate and unconnected characters? Something else in between?

It has been a long time since I picked up the books or rpg but as I recall the eternal champion is a possessing entity with its own agenda. I've got to agree. It is an entirely different build with no skill or attribute over lap. Just some memory transference. You jump from 25 point normal human to 250+ near God like being.

Yeah, the few times where multiple Champions were in the same place at the same time were to battle against multiverse-threatening entities* and even then the fates wouldn't risk more than 4 ECs in the same place at the same time for fear of sundering reality (which would kind of defeat the purpose of the EC).  So, really, the EC spirit is just SFX for having different but linked characters in different campaigns.
